A Closer Look at Dave Portnoy's Journey

Early Beginnings and Career Evolution

Born in New York City on April 28, 1977, Dave Portnoy's professional life has been one of constant reinvention. He started in the world of finance before quickly recognizing his deep passion for sports and its potential to connect with a broad audience. That passion led him to create Barstool Sports, a platform celebrated for its raw, unfiltered commentary and its ability to cultivate a dedicated and engaged community, particularly among younger demographics.

Barstool Sports

Launched in 2003, Barstool Sports has grown into a major multimedia force, covering a wide array of sports-related topics, from the major professional leagues to the intricacies of college athletics and much, much more. Under Portnoy's leadership, the platform thrives on a distinctive approach: challenging conventions and providing content that speaks directly to its audience. His innovative approach has been instrumental in Barstool's growth and the impact it's had on the media landscape.

Understanding the Kentucky Derby

Known as the "The Most Exciting Two Minutes in Sports," the Kentucky Derby is far more than just a race; it is a cultural event steeped in history. Held annually since 1875 at Churchill Downs in Louisville, Kentucky, the Derby is the first jewel in the Triple Crown of Thoroughbred Racing in the United States. It is a race that encapsulates tradition, drawing enthusiasts from around the globe to witness the spectacle.

History and Timeless Traditions

From its inception, the Kentucky Derby has been shaped by tradition. The iconic twin spires of Churchill Downs, the mint julep, and the elaborate hats worn by attendees all are hallmarks of this event. Over the decades, the Derby has evolved into a cultural phenomenon that draws enthusiasts from around the globe. This creates a vibrant mix of old and new, of tradition and modernity.

Time-Honored Traditions of the Kentucky Derby

The Kentucky Derby is filled with customs that have been treasured for many generations. From the emotional rendition of "My Old Kentucky Home" to the iconic garland of roses awarded to the winning horse, these traditions define the Derby's enduring allure and charm. These aren't just formalities; they're an intrinsic part of what makes the Derby special.

Iconic Elements of the Derby

  • The Twin Spires: An instantly recognizable symbol of Churchill Downs and a defining feature of the Derby's visual identity, the twin spires are the first thing that many people think of when they hear "Kentucky Derby."
  • The Mint Julep: The official cocktail of the Kentucky Derby, enjoyed by countless attendees as they embrace the atmosphere and revel in the festivities. It's practically a requirement for full Derby enjoyment.
  • Fashion: The Derby is synonymous with extravagant hats and stylish attire, making it as much a fashion spectacle as a sporting event. The fashion is a huge part of the show, and part of what draws in so many people.

The Economic Impact of the Kentucky Derby

The Kentucky Derby has a large economic impact on the local community and far beyond. From hotel reservations to dining and entertainment, the event generates millions of dollars in revenue annually.

Economic Contributions of the Derby

  • Local Businesses: Restaurants, hotels, and shops flourish during the Derby, gaining significantly from the influx of visitors and tourists. Everyone profits from this big event.
  • Job Creation: The Derby generates numerous temporary job opportunities across many sectors, contributing to the local economy's health and vitality. It's not just a fun event; it's a huge economic driver.
